Abstract
- The rapid growth of Islamic banking has attracted muchattention lately in the economic literature. The main goal of this paper is toinvestigate the relationship between the Islamic banking, economic growth andinnovation using data for the five Gulf Arab States (Bahrain, United ArabEmirates, Kuwait, Qatar and Saudi Arabia) in the period of 2001–2015. In theempirical analysis where the panel data method is used, unit root andco-integration tests were applied to the variables. It is postulated that accordingto the test findings, economic growth is co-integrated with Islamic banking andpatent application. Long run co-integration coefficients of the variables wereanalysed throughout the panel using the method of Panel Dynamic Ordinary LeastSquares (PDOLS). The conclusion of the empirical study indicates that Islamicbanking funds and innovation in chosen Gulf Arab states have positive andsignificant relations with economic growth.
